.elementor-8876 .elementor-element.elementor-element-616b347{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--margin-top:0px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-8876 .elementor-element.elementor-element-0810ae7{width:var( --container-widget-width, 100% );max-width:100%;--container-widget-width:100%;--container-widget-flex-grow:0;}.elementor-8876 .elementor-element.elementor-element-0810ae7 > .elementor-widget-container{margin:0px 0px 0px 0px;padding:0px 0px 0px 0px;}.elementor-8876 .elementor-element.elementor-element-0810ae7 .elementor-wrapper{--video-aspect-ratio:1.77777;}.elementor-8876 .elementor-element.elementor-element-5a6fcd3{width:var( --container-widget-width, 100% );max-width:100%;--container-widget-width:100%;--container-widget-flex-grow:0;top:0px;z-index:2;}.elementor-8876 .elementor-element.elementor-element-5a6fcd3 > .elementor-widget-container{margin:0px 0px 0px 0px;padding:0px 0px 0px 0px;}body:not(.rtl) .elementor-8876 .elementor-element.elementor-element-5a6fcd3{left:0px;}body.rtl .elementor-8876 .elementor-element.elementor-element-5a6fcd3{right:0px;}.elementor-8876 .elementor-element.elementor-element-5a6fcd3:not( .elementor-widget-image ) .elementor-widget-container, .elementor-8876 .elementor-element.elementor-element-5a6fcd3.elementor-widget-image .elementor-widget-container img{-webkit-mask-image:url( https://high-as-a-kite.co.uk/wp-content/uploads/2025/12/temp.png );-webkit-mask-size:contain;-webkit-mask-position:center center;-webkit-mask-repeat:no-repeat;}.elementor-8876 .elementor-element.elementor-element-5a6fcd3 .elementor-wrapper{--video-aspect-ratio:1.77777;}:root{--page-title-display:none;}/* Start custom CSS */.blur-video video {
  filter: blur(10px);
  transform: scale(1.1); /* hides blur edges */
}
.video-text-mask {
  position: relative;
  z-index: 3;

  color: transparent;
  background: black;

  -webkit-background-clip: text;
  background-clip: text;
}
.video-text-mask {
  mask-image: text;
  -webkit-mask-image: text;
}/* End custom CSS */